stats: fix typo

This commit is contained in:
Enrico Schwendig 2023-04-03 12:37:55 +02:00
parent cb0ba6d827
commit 889a31489b
5 changed files with 20 additions and 20 deletions

View file

@ -53,7 +53,7 @@
"i18next-browser-languagedetector": "^6.1.8", "i18next-browser-languagedetector": "^6.1.8",
"i18next-http-backend": "^1.4.4", "i18next-http-backend": "^1.4.4",
"lodash": "^4.17.21", "lodash": "^4.17.21",
"matrix-js-sdk": "github:matrix-org/matrix-js-sdk#d1cf98b1770d0282224e80bc9303609f6c156d3a", "matrix-js-sdk": "github:matrix-org/matrix-js-sdk#fe79a6fa7ca50fc7d078e11826b5539bb0822c45",
"matrix-widget-api": "^1.3.1", "matrix-widget-api": "^1.3.1",
"mermaid": "^8.13.8", "mermaid": "^8.13.8",
"normalize.css": "^8.0.1", "normalize.css": "^8.0.1",

View file

@ -37,7 +37,7 @@ import {
import { import {
ConnectionStatsReport, ConnectionStatsReport,
ByteSentStatsReport, ByteSentStatsReport,
SummeryStatsReport, SummaryStatsReport,
} from "matrix-js-sdk/src/webrtc/stats/statsReport"; } from "matrix-js-sdk/src/webrtc/stats/statsReport";
import { setSpan } from "@opentelemetry/api/build/esm/trace/context-utils"; import { setSpan } from "@opentelemetry/api/build/esm/trace/context-utils";
@ -334,11 +334,11 @@ export class OTelGroupCallMembership {
this.buildStatsEventSpan({ type, data }); this.buildStatsEventSpan({ type, data });
} }
public onSummeryStatsReport( public onSummaryStatsReport(
statsReport: GroupCallStatsReport<SummeryStatsReport> statsReport: GroupCallStatsReport<SummaryStatsReport>
) { ) {
const type = OTelStatsReportType.SummeryStatsReport; const type = OTelStatsReportType.SummaryStatsReport;
const data = ObjectFlattener.flattenSummeryStatsReportObject(statsReport); const data = ObjectFlattener.flattenSummaryStatsReportObject(statsReport);
this.buildStatsEventSpan({ type, data }); this.buildStatsEventSpan({ type, data });
} }
@ -391,5 +391,5 @@ interface OTelStatsReportEvent {
enum OTelStatsReportType { enum OTelStatsReportType {
ConnectionStatsReport = "matrix.stats.connection", ConnectionStatsReport = "matrix.stats.connection",
ByteSentStatsReport = "matrix.stats.byteSent", ByteSentStatsReport = "matrix.stats.byteSent",
SummeryStatsReport = "matrix.stats.summery", SummaryStatsReport = "matrix.stats.summary",
} }

View file

@ -18,7 +18,7 @@ import { GroupCallStatsReport } from "matrix-js-sdk/src/webrtc/groupCall";
import { import {
ByteSentStatsReport, ByteSentStatsReport,
ConnectionStatsReport, ConnectionStatsReport,
SummeryStatsReport, SummaryStatsReport,
} from "matrix-js-sdk/src/webrtc/stats/statsReport"; } from "matrix-js-sdk/src/webrtc/stats/statsReport";
export class ObjectFlattener { export class ObjectFlattener {
@ -48,14 +48,14 @@ export class ObjectFlattener {
return flatObject; return flatObject;
} }
static flattenSummeryStatsReportObject( static flattenSummaryStatsReportObject(
statsReport: GroupCallStatsReport<SummeryStatsReport> statsReport: GroupCallStatsReport<SummaryStatsReport>
) { ) {
const flatObject = {}; const flatObject = {};
ObjectFlattener.flattenObjectRecursive( ObjectFlattener.flattenObjectRecursive(
statsReport.report, statsReport.report,
flatObject, flatObject,
"matrix.stats.summery.", "matrix.stats.summary.",
0 0
); );
return flatObject; return flatObject;

View file

@ -33,7 +33,7 @@ import { MatrixClient } from "matrix-js-sdk";
import { import {
ByteSentStatsReport, ByteSentStatsReport,
ConnectionStatsReport, ConnectionStatsReport,
SummeryStatsReport, SummaryStatsReport,
} from "matrix-js-sdk/src/webrtc/stats/statsReport"; } from "matrix-js-sdk/src/webrtc/stats/statsReport";
import { usePageUnload } from "./usePageUnload"; import { usePageUnload } from "./usePageUnload";
@ -356,10 +356,10 @@ export function useGroupCall(
groupCallOTelMembership?.onByteSentStatsReport(report); groupCallOTelMembership?.onByteSentStatsReport(report);
} }
function onSummeryStatsReport( function onSummaryStatsReport(
report: GroupCallStatsReport<SummeryStatsReport> report: GroupCallStatsReport<SummaryStatsReport>
): void { ): void {
groupCallOTelMembership?.onSummeryStatsReport(report); groupCallOTelMembership?.onSummaryStatsReport(report);
} }
groupCall.on(GroupCallEvent.GroupCallStateChanged, onGroupCallStateChanged); groupCall.on(GroupCallEvent.GroupCallStateChanged, onGroupCallStateChanged);
@ -388,7 +388,7 @@ export function useGroupCall(
onByteSentStatsReport onByteSentStatsReport
); );
groupCall.on(GroupCallStatsReportEvent.SummeryStats, onSummeryStatsReport); groupCall.on(GroupCallStatsReportEvent.SummaryStats, onSummaryStatsReport);
updateState({ updateState({
error: null, error: null,
@ -445,8 +445,8 @@ export function useGroupCall(
onByteSentStatsReport onByteSentStatsReport
); );
groupCall.removeListener( groupCall.removeListener(
GroupCallStatsReportEvent.SummeryStats, GroupCallStatsReportEvent.SummaryStats,
onSummeryStatsReport onSummaryStatsReport
); );
leaveCall(); leaveCall();
}; };

View file

@ -10550,9 +10550,9 @@ matrix-events-sdk@0.0.1:
resolved "https://registry.yarnpkg.com/matrix-events-sdk/-/matrix-events-sdk-0.0.1.tgz#c8c38911e2cb29023b0bbac8d6f32e0de2c957dd" resolved "https://registry.yarnpkg.com/matrix-events-sdk/-/matrix-events-sdk-0.0.1.tgz#c8c38911e2cb29023b0bbac8d6f32e0de2c957dd"
integrity sha512-1QEOsXO+bhyCroIe2/A5OwaxHvBm7EsSQ46DEDn8RBIfQwN5HWBpFvyWWR4QY0KHPPnnJdI99wgRiAl7Ad5qaA== integrity sha512-1QEOsXO+bhyCroIe2/A5OwaxHvBm7EsSQ46DEDn8RBIfQwN5HWBpFvyWWR4QY0KHPPnnJdI99wgRiAl7Ad5qaA==
"matrix-js-sdk@github:matrix-org/matrix-js-sdk#d1cf98b1770d0282224e80bc9303609f6c156d3a": "matrix-js-sdk@github:matrix-org/matrix-js-sdk#fe79a6fa7ca50fc7d078e11826b5539bb0822c45":
version "24.0.0" version "24.0.0"
resolved "https://codeload.github.com/matrix-org/matrix-js-sdk/tar.gz/d1cf98b1770d0282224e80bc9303609f6c156d3a" resolved "https://codeload.github.com/matrix-org/matrix-js-sdk/tar.gz/fe79a6fa7ca50fc7d078e11826b5539bb0822c45"
dependencies: dependencies:
"@babel/runtime" "^7.12.5" "@babel/runtime" "^7.12.5"
"@matrix-org/matrix-sdk-crypto-js" "^0.1.0-alpha.5" "@matrix-org/matrix-sdk-crypto-js" "^0.1.0-alpha.5"